In this episode, hosts Catherine Nichols and Sandra Newman talk about the short stories of Anton Chekhov, particularly "Lady With a Little Dog" and "Ward No. 6." What do these stories tell us about the revolutionary sentiment that was about to change not just Russia but the world? The stories embody a radical hopelessness, but also a harsh judgment of that hopelessness. Do we need to continue to hope in order to be good people? And is Chekhov telling us that (partly for that reason) it's not possible for some people to be good?
